Does iMagic Inventory support
barcode scanners?
Yes. You can use just about any
barcode scanner with iMagic
Inventory. Most computer shops sell
reasonably priced barcode scanners.
If you ask the sales clerk if the
scanner inserts the "scanned barcode
into the keyboard buffer" then you
can be sure. You might also like to
try the barcode scanners offered by
Flic. They offer simple, affordable
barcode scanners compatible with
iMagic Inventory. You can find them
at
www.flicscanner.com.

Does iMagic Inventory Software
support multiple users?
Yes iMagic Inventory Software can be
used on a LAN by several users at
once.
To setup multiple users you would
install the software onto each PC
that needs it. Then designate one as
the main/server PC, this then shares
it's database with the other PCs on
the network.
It takes a few steps to setup the
network feature. As follows:
-
Install the software onto the server, this will
then be the central database. Configure and
setup the system and other details as required.
-
Still on the server, create a
share to the folder in which you
installed the software. You can do
this in Windows 2000 by right
clicking on the folder and selecting
Sharing. You'll then want to give
full read and write access.
-
Install the software onto each
workstation (don't run it just yet).
-
On each workstation run the
Network Administration program
(found by pressing Start/Program
Files/iMagic Inventory). Follow the
wizard and set the database path to
the share that was created on the
server.
-
You can now run the software on
each workstation and it will use the
database on the server.

How can I change the default
currency setting?
iMagic Inventory Software uses the
system's currency setting. To change
this to a different currency:
-
Press Start/Settings/Control
Panel.
-
Select Regional Options.
-
Select the Currency Tab.
-
Change the Currency Symbol to
your currency and click OK.
iMagic Inventory Software will now
use your currency.

I am wondering if iMagic
Inventory has a limit to the number
of inventory items the database will
hold?
The upper limit depends on the speed
of your PC, available RAM etc. The
average PC should be able to deal
with 20,000 items. A more powerful
PC can handle many times that.

For receiving stock, does iMagic
Inventory automatically increase the
"number in stock" count each time a
particular barcode is scanned, or is
further user input needed to enter
the quantity?
Yes iMagic Inventory can
automatically increase stock levels
when it arrives. From the main menu
select Inventory/Receive Stock.
Top of Page
For outgoing stock, are scanned
items automatically deducted from
the "number in stock" count and
moved to the invoice?
Yes as you add items to the invoice
the stock level is automatically
updated.
Top of Page
How can I backup iMagic
Inventory?
You'll need to backup the database
file called db.mdb, by
default this is installed in the
c:\Program Files\iMagic Inventory
folder. To restore from the backup,
copy the file back.

How can I stop iMagic Inventory
from rounding the currency values
entered? Say I want to enter
$0.0237, it always rounds it to
$0.02.
The number of decimal places is
controlled by Windows. If you select
Start/Configure/Control Panel and
then Regional Settings and then
Currency. You can change the number
of decimal places.
